Modulations: A Landmark 90s Electronic Music Documentary

Before video streaming platforms like YouTube dominated the internet, Viddler.com served as a popular hosting site for a variety of content. Among its offerings was a significant electronic music documentary from the 1990s titled "Modulations" that was shared by user "viddlerbuba".

About the Documentary

Based on discussions from The People's Republic of Cork forums, "Modulations" was highly regarded as an in-depth exploration of electronic dance music (EDM). What made this documentary particularly noteworthy was its comprehensive approach to the genre's history, tracing EDM back to its origins while covering a diverse range of styles.

Forum members particularly appreciated that "Modulations" was "more focussed on EDM" while still maintaining historical context. One commenter noted it was "by far the best one i've seen yet" and "much more universal than Universal Techno," referring to another documentary in the genre.

The Moog Pronunciation

An interesting point raised in the discussion was the documentary's correct pronunciation of "Moog" (the famous synthesizer brand). One commenter mentioned this was "the first one I've seen where 'Moog' is actually pronounced correctly." This sparked a side conversation about how Robert Moog reportedly changed the pronunciation from "mooh-g" to "moh-g" because his wife, a teacher, "used to get hassle from the kids" about the original pronunciation.

Cultural Significance

The enthusiasm in the forum posts suggests "Modulations" held significant cultural value for electronic music enthusiasts. One commenter mentioned they "had the sticker but missed the film when it was out," indicating the documentary had promotional materials and likely a theatrical or festival release.

While the original video is no longer available on Viddler (which ceased operations in 2022), "Modulations" appears to have been an important documentary for understanding the evolution of electronic music in its various forms.
